Understanding Curaçao

Curaçao as a Constituent Country of the Kingdom of the Netherlands

Curaçao is a constituent country within the Kingdom of the Netherlands, located in the southern Caribbean Sea. Along with Aruba and Sint Maarten, it forms part of the Caribbean islands that make up the Dutch Caribbean.

As a constituent country, Curaçao has its own government, constitution, and legislative system, while still maintaining ties with the Netherlands.

Culture, History, and Demographics of Curaçao

Curaçao boasts a rich and diverse cultural heritage shaped by its history and blend of influences. The island has been inhabited for centuries, with indigenous Arawak and Caquetio tribes residing there before European colonization.

Curaçao was initially settled by the Spanish in the early 16th century and later became a Dutch colony.

The cultural makeup of Curaçao reflects the intermingling of various ethnicities, including African, Dutch, Portuguese, Jewish, and Latin American.

This fusion has given rise to a vibrant culture characterized by music, dance, cuisine, and a distinct local language known as Papiamentu.

Jonathan Schoop: Early Life and Roots

Birthdate, Birthplace, and Family Background

Jonathan Rufino Jezus Schoop, commonly known as Jonathan Schoop, was born on October 16, 1991. He was born in Willemstad, the capital city of Curaçao.

Journey to the Major Leagues

From Curaçao to the United States

Jonathan Schoop’s journey from Curaçao to the United States began with his talent catching the attention of scouts. Recognizing his potential, he signed with the Baltimore Orioles as an international free agent in 2008 at the age of 16.

This marked the start of his professional baseball career and the first step toward reaching the Major Leagues.

Ascent Through the Minor Leagues and Mlb Debut

After signing with the Orioles, Schoop embarked on his minor league journey. He worked his way up through various levels of the Orioles’ minor league system, showcasing his skills and consistently improving his performance.

His strong play caught the attention of the organization and propelled him closer to his goal of reaching the MLB.

Schoop made his MLB debut on September 25, 2013, with the Baltimore Orioles. In his first game, he recorded his first hit, a double, against the Toronto Blue Jays.

Schoop’s debut marked the beginning of his career as a Major League Baseball player, and he soon established himself as a reliable contributor to the Orioles’ lineup.
